# Brian Buss

**Headline:** Aerospace and Defense Project Leader
**Profession:** Chief Technology Officer
**Location:** Westlake Village, California, United States

## About

Brian Buss is an aerospace and defense project leader who currently serves as Chief Technology Officer at Power Sonix Inc\., while also working as a Project Manager and Certified ISO9001/AS9100 Auditor at Cambio Services LLC\. He helps manufacturing organizations clarify compliance requirements, build scalable processes, and implement software tools for quality assurance, environmental compliance, supply\-chain management, and corporate social responsibility\. Brian’s strengths include client discovery, requirements gathering, statements of work, product definition, stakeholder buy\-in, shifting\-priority management, and project execution\. Across aerospace, automotive, electronics, medical\-device, and industrial manufacturing, Brian has led quality, compliance, supplier\-development, engineering, and program\-management work\. He has managed AS9100, ISO9001, ISO13485, TS16949, NADCAP, FAA, ISO14001, UL, REACH, RoHS, conflict\-minerals, and California Prop 65 requirements\. His experience includes leading Benchmark Electronics’ New Product Introduction Center of Excellence implementing a global APQP system at Interlink Electronics supporting AS9100\- and FAA\-certified operations at Eaton Aerospace and reducing customer\-return analysis time by 65% at Visteon\. Brian holds a BSME in Mechanical Engineering with a minor in Communications from Purdue University and is a Certified Quality Engineer and ISO 9001/AS9100 Lead Auditor\.
